Alternative Cyl Head Temp Method
Joe Recard and jmcleod's posts to the thread "914 Thermostat.. does yours have one" both mentioned CHT sensors: A little story.
One day while fooling around on my bench with a stock center console oil temp gauge, I hooked it up to a CHT sensor and applied 12 Volts. The gauge read zero. I applied heat to the sensor with my hot air gun and the guage needle started to go up. When I held the heat on (it is a 1500 watt gun) for awhile, the gauge needle went up to close to full scale. So what does this imply? I think that if you have carbs, you could hook up the stock CHT sensor to an oil temp gauge. You wouldn't know what the temp reading is but, you would have a very inexpensive, relative reading, CHT gauge. Of course, we don't know what the heck the center console oil temp gauge reads either.
